Configure failover settings

Do not modify the following settings without first consulting
BlackBerry AtHoc
customer support.
Most settings in the Desktop App settings page are established during the initial installation and configuration with the assistance of
BlackBerry AtHoc
customer support. The settings in the Failover section of the Desktop App settings page are used to enable the primary
BlackBerry AtHoc
server to fail over to a secondary server when the primary server becomes unresponsive and CUs fail.
  1. In the navigation bar, click The Settings icon.
  2. In the
    Devices
    section, click
    Desktop App
    .
  3. On the
    Desktop App
    window, scroll down to the
    Failover
    section.
  4. Enter the URL for the failover server.
  5. Select a value from the
    Reconnect attempts before Failover
    list.
    This setting specifies the number of attempts that the Desktop app makes to contact the primary server before switching to the failover server.
  6. Click
    Save
    .
